He Creek
He Creek is a stream in Sequatchie, Tennessee. He Creek is situated nearby to the hamlet Chalybeate, as well as near Curtistown.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Spring Creek
Hamlet
Spring Creek is an unincorporated community in Warren County, Tennessee, United States. Spring Creek is located in the southeast corner of Warren County 12 miles southeast of McMinnville. Spring Creek is situated 5 miles northwest of He Creek.
Cagle
Hamlet
Cagle is an unincorporated community in Sequatchie County, Tennessee, United States. It is concentrated around the intersection of Tennessee State Route 111 and Tennessee State Route 399 atop the Cumberland Plateau in the western part of the county. Cagle is situated 6 miles southeast of He Creek.
